hi_my_god 2021-11-12 13:14 采纳率: 0%
浏览 1

QSqlConnect连不上,Navacat能

QSqlDatabase DbHelper::GetDatabase()
{
    if(QSqlDatabase::contains(_connectionString))
    {
        return QSqlDatabase::database(_connectionString);
    }
    else
    {
        QSqlDatabase db=QSqlDatabase::addDatabase("QMYSQL",_connectionString);
        db.setHostName(_hostName);
        db.setDatabaseName(_dbName);
        db.setUserName(_userName);
        db.setPassword(_password);
        db.setPort(_port);

        qDebug()<<db.connectOptions()<<_connectionString<<_hostName<<","<<_dbName<<","<<_userName<<","<<_password<<","<<_port<<endl;
        return db;
    }
}

debug输出:"" "{d7420420-c24e-48f6-8eef-707ce62f7f19}" "127.0.0.1" , "salemanagedb" , "root" , "root" , 4040

img

  • 写回答

1条回答 默认 最新

  • 爷就是这个范儿 2021-11-12 13:29
    关注

    两个问题,第一个你检查连接mysql的驱动是否正常,或者说你是不是第一次连接mysql。第二个你链接的数据库"salemanagedb是否存在。

    评论 编辑记录

报告相同问题?

问题事件

  • 创建了问题 11月12日

悬赏问题

  • ¥100 任意维数的K均值聚类
  • ¥15 stamps做sbas-insar,时序沉降图怎么画
  • ¥15 unity第一人称射击小游戏,有demo,在原脚本的基础上进行修改以达到要求
  • ¥15 买了个传感器,根据商家发的代码和步骤使用但是代码报错了不会改,有没有人可以看看
  • ¥15 关于#Java#的问题,如何解决?
  • ¥15 加热介质是液体,换热器壳侧导热系数和总的导热系数怎么算
  • ¥100 嵌入式系统基于PIC16F882和热敏电阻的数字温度计
  • ¥15 cmd cl 0x000007b
  • ¥20 BAPI_PR_CHANGE how to add account assignment information for service line
  • ¥500 火焰左右视图、视差(基于双目相机)